In the morning, visit the Immaculate Conception Church, one of the famous landmarks of Goa, and enjoy the old-world charm of the Fontainhas neighborhood. In the afternoon, head to the Goa State Museum to learn about the history and culture of the state. In the evening, take a stroll at the Miramar Beach and relax while watching a beautiful sunset.
In the morning, visit the Basilica of Bom Jesus, a UNESCO World Heritage Site and an example of Baroque architecture. Afterward, explore the Se Cathedral, dedicated to Saint Catherine. In the afternoon, explore the Reis Magos Fort and enjoy the stunning views of the Mandovi River. In the evening, go for a boat ride on the river and admire the city's illuminated skyline.
In the morning, head to the Baga Beach and enjoy some water activities like parasailing and jet skiing. In the afternoon, visit the iconic Aguada Fort, which offers spectacular views of the Arabian Sea, and don't forget to take a picture at the famous Dil Chahta Hai point. In the evening, head to the Anjuna Beach and enjoy some live music and nightlife.
If you have extra time in Goa, you can consider visiting the Dudhsagar Waterfalls or taking a spice plantation tour. You can also take a side trip to the quiet town of Ponda, famous for its temples and plantations. To maximize your fun, try the local cuisine, especially seafood, and attend a Goan carnival or cultural event. It's also recommended to rent a scooter or bike to explore the city at your own pace.
